Becoming a PNGTuber used to mean commissioning an artist, waiting a week or two, and paying for every extra expression afterwards. PNGTuber Maker exists to make the first version of that character something you can have in a few minutes, from a sentence you wrote yourself.
You describe a character. We generate four candidates so you are choosing rather than accepting whatever came back first. You pick one, and we generate the frame set a stream actually needs from that same character: idle, talking, blinking, and blinking while talking, each on a transparent background and sized to drop straight into OBS as an image source.
Holding one character's face steady across four separate generations is the part that is genuinely hard, and it is the part we spend our engineering on. The frames are generated from the candidate you picked, not from your prompt a second time, which is why the four frames look like the same character instead of four cousins.

Credits are held, not taken, while a generation runs. If it fails they go back automatically. If half of it arrives, you are refunded the whole run and you keep the images that did.

We do not train our own image models. Your prompt is sent to an established model — GPT Image 2 from OpenAI — through the Kie platform, and the images that come back are stored in our own private storage rather than left on a vendor's server. The price per image is on the pricing page.
Every generated image is checked for a genuinely transparent background before it is delivered, because a PNGTuber frame with a white box behind it is useless on stream. When a model returns one that fails that check, we re-run the repair at our own cost.

We are not a Live2D rig. There is no face tracking, no physics and no mouth-shape detection from your microphone. A PNGTuber is a small set of still frames that swap while you talk, and that is deliberate — it runs on any machine and needs no camera.
